Is Lake Tahoe Water Safe to Drink? A Deep Dive

Generally speaking, Lake Tahoe’s water is exceptionally pure and meets drinking water standards in its central body, thanks to its oligotrophic nature and rigorous monitoring. However, drinking directly from the lake without treatment is strongly discouraged due to potential risks from localized contamination, seasonal runoff, and recreational activity.

Understanding Lake Tahoe’s Water Quality

Lake Tahoe is renowned for its breathtaking clarity and pristine waters. This clarity is primarily due to its oligotrophic nature, meaning it’s low in nutrients like phosphorus and nitrogen that fuel algae growth. This natural characteristic, combined with effective environmental regulations, has historically contributed to the lake’s impressive water quality.

However, relying solely on the lake’s inherent purity for drinking water is a risky proposition. Factors like urban runoff, atmospheric deposition, and the increasing presence of invasive species can negatively impact water quality, particularly in nearshore areas and during specific times of the year. Furthermore, the presence of microscopic organisms, even in low concentrations, poses a potential health risk.

The Potential Risks of Untreated Lake Water

While Lake Tahoe’s central body generally has very high-quality water, risks associated with drinking untreated water include:

  • Pathogens: Bacteria, viruses, and protozoa (like Giardia and Cryptosporidium) can contaminate the water through animal waste or sewage spills. These can cause gastrointestinal illnesses.
  • Chemical Contaminants: Runoff from roads and urban areas can carry pollutants like gasoline, oil, and pesticides into the lake.
  • Algae Blooms: While rare in Lake Tahoe compared to some other lakes, algal blooms can occur and some species produce toxins harmful to humans.
  • Microplastics: Tiny plastic particles are increasingly found in waterways, including Lake Tahoe, and their long-term health effects are not fully understood.

Even if the water appears crystal clear, these contaminants may be present in quantities sufficient to cause illness, especially in individuals with weakened immune systems, children, and the elderly.

Best Practices for Safe Drinking Water

To ensure safe drinking water while enjoying Lake Tahoe, follow these guidelines:

  • Never drink untreated water directly from the lake or streams.
  • Rely on treated tap water from municipal water systems. These systems adhere to strict water quality standards and regularly test for contaminants.
  • If hiking or camping, bring your own purified water or use a portable water filter or purifier. Ensure the filter is certified to remove bacteria, viruses, and protozoa.
  • Boil water vigorously for at least one minute (three minutes at higher altitudes) to kill most harmful microorganisms.
  • Be aware of advisories issued by local health authorities regarding water quality.

H3: 1. Is the water in Lake Tahoe tested regularly?

Yes, the Tahoe Regional Planning Agency (TRPA) and various other agencies, including the Lahontan Regional Water Quality Control Board, conduct regular monitoring and testing of Lake Tahoe’s water quality. These tests assess a wide range of parameters, including clarity, nutrient levels, and the presence of contaminants. This comprehensive monitoring program helps track the lake’s health and identify potential issues.

H3: 2. Can I filter Lake Tahoe water and make it safe to drink?

Filtering Lake Tahoe water can significantly reduce the risk of contamination, but it’s crucial to use a filter that is specifically designed to remove bacteria, viruses, and protozoa. A filter with a pore size of 0.2 microns or smaller is recommended for removing these pathogens. Look for filters certified to NSF/ANSI Standard 53 or 58. While filtering can remove many contaminants, it may not eliminate all chemical pollutants, so it’s still advisable to prioritize treated water whenever possible.

H3: 3. What about boiling Lake Tahoe water; does that make it safe?

Boiling is an effective method for killing most harmful microorganisms in water. Boil the water vigorously for at least one minute (three minutes at higher altitudes) to ensure adequate disinfection. However, boiling does not remove chemical contaminants or heavy metals. It’s best to use boiling in conjunction with other purification methods, such as filtration, when using Lake Tahoe water as a source.

H3: 4. Are there specific areas of Lake Tahoe where the water is less safe to drink?

Generally, nearshore areas, especially those near urban development or areas with heavy recreational use, are more likely to have higher levels of contamination than the central body of the lake. Streams and rivers flowing into the lake can also carry pollutants. Avoid drinking water from these areas without proper treatment.

H3: 5. How does runoff affect Lake Tahoe’s water quality?

Stormwater runoff can carry a variety of pollutants into the lake, including sediment, nutrients, oil, gasoline, pesticides, and bacteria. Effective stormwater management practices are crucial for protecting Lake Tahoe’s water quality. These practices include reducing impervious surfaces, implementing erosion control measures, and using best management practices in urban areas.

H3: 6. Is the treated tap water around Lake Tahoe safe to drink?

Yes, treated tap water supplied by municipal water systems around Lake Tahoe is generally safe to drink. These systems treat and disinfect the water to meet stringent drinking water standards set by the EPA and state agencies. Regular testing ensures that the water is free from harmful contaminants.

H3: 7. Are there any specific concerns about microplastics in Lake Tahoe water?

Microplastics are an emerging concern in aquatic environments, including Lake Tahoe. While the extent of microplastic contamination in Lake Tahoe is still being studied, it’s likely that microplastics are present. Standard water treatment processes may not completely remove microplastics. The long-term health effects of microplastic ingestion are not fully understood, highlighting the importance of reducing plastic pollution.

H3: 8. What are the symptoms of getting sick from contaminated water?

Symptoms of illness from contaminated water can vary depending on the type of contaminant but commonly include gastrointestinal distress, such as nausea, vomiting, diarrhea, and abdominal cramps. Other symptoms may include fever, headache, and fatigue. If you experience these symptoms after drinking untreated water, seek medical attention.

H3: 9. What are the local regulations regarding water use around Lake Tahoe?

Local regulations around Lake Tahoe aim to protect the lake’s water quality and clarity. These regulations include restrictions on development near the shoreline, requirements for stormwater management, and limitations on the use of fertilizers. The TRPA plays a key role in enforcing these regulations and promoting sustainable practices.

H3: 10. Can I use water from Lake Tahoe to fill my RV water tank?

While it’s tempting to utilize the lake water to fill an RV tank, it is strongly advised that you do not. Unless your RV has a robust water filtration system, it is not advisable to use the water for drinking or cooking purposes, and even for showering it presents a risk. It’s always best to fill the tank with water from a known source that is safe for potable use.

H3: 11. How does climate change affect Lake Tahoe’s water quality?

Climate change can impact Lake Tahoe’s water quality in several ways. Warmer water temperatures can promote algae growth, potentially leading to harmful algal blooms. Changes in precipitation patterns can affect runoff and nutrient loading. Increased frequency and intensity of wildfires can also contribute to sediment and ash entering the lake.

H3: 12. Who should I contact if I suspect water contamination in Lake Tahoe?

If you suspect water contamination in Lake Tahoe, contact the Lahontan Regional Water Quality Control Board or the Nevada Division of Environmental Protection (NDEP), depending on the location of the suspected contamination. You can also contact the Tahoe Regional Planning Agency (TRPA). Reporting suspected contamination helps authorities investigate and take appropriate action to protect water quality.
